Özet

We present a full key-recovery ciphertext-only attack on the tweakable block cipher Halfloop-24 which is standardized by the US military and NATO for use in the Automatic Link Establishment protocol for high-frequency radio. Our attack is based on the observation that the probability-one differential, which was used for known- and chosen-plaintext attacks in prior works, can be viewed as a probability-p differential when the plaintexts are unknown, where p is the network-dependent probability that plaintext differences line up with tweak differences. Further, due to the fact that the tweak is publicly known, the specific values of the plaintexts are not necessary to identify the correct key. Our attack has a theoretical complexity of roughly 265 encryptions, given a favorable ALE network setup that allows us to collect enough suitable ciphertexts. To give a hardware-grounded estimate of the cost of the whole attack, we provide optimized CPU and GPU implementations.
